Vande Bharat Sleeper will run between New Delhi - Howrah; Know Schedule, & Ticket Prices
Delhi-Howrah Vande Bharat Train: Good news has come for the passengers going from Delhi to Howrah. Indian Railways will soon run Vande Bharat Sleeper Train between New Delhi and Howrah. Let us tell you that at present Vande Bharat Sleeper Train is being operated on many routes within the country. This train runs at a speed of 150 to 160 km per hour.
Let us tell you that at present Rajdhani Express and Duronto Express are already running on the route from Delhi to Howrah, but the speed of Vande Bharat Sleeper Train will be more than both of them.
Due to this, this train will cover the distance of 1,449 km between Delhi and Howrah in just 15 hours.

Train timing and fare
Let us tell you that the Vande Bharat Sleeper train starting between Delhi and Howrah will have a total of 16 coaches. It will have 1 coach of First Class AC, 4 coaches for Second Tier AC and 11 coaches for Third Tier AC. Talking about the fare, it is expected to be around Rs 5,100 for Vande Bharat Sleeper train, Rs 4,000 for Second Tier AC and Rs 3,000 for Third Tier AC.
In this train, passengers will get better facilities along with travelling at a fast speed.
According to the information, this train will depart from New Delhi Railway Station (NDLS) at 5 pm every day in the evening, which will reach Howrah at 8 am the next day. After this, during the return, this train will leave Howrah at 5 pm, after which it will reach New Delhi at 8 am the next day.
Vande Bharat train will stop at these stations
While travelling on the New Delhi to Howrah route, Vande Bharat train will stop at many stations. These include Kanpur Central, Prayagraj Junction, Deen Dayal Upadhyay Junction, Gaya, Dhanbad, Asansol Junction. This train will be more beneficial for those who want to travel quickly between Delhi and Howrah. Similarly, it will be very easy for people coming from Howrah to Delhi. This train will be started soon.
